Police name 38-year-old man killed Monday morning after being hit by DART bus

The Wilmington Police Department has identified the man fatally struck by a DART bus Monday morning as 38-year-old Glenn DuPont.

Police said DuPont was found injured on the 100 block of N. Monroe St. in Wilmington's West Center City neighborhood at 5:49 a.m. on Monday. He later died, but police did not say when or where.

Wilmington police did not say that DuPont was hit by a bus in the initial news release, but the Delaware Department of Transportation confirmed that a bus had hit the man later that day. Police clarified Tuesday evening that DuPont was hit by a bus.

The crash is still under investigation. Anyone with information is asked to contact Cpl. Keith Johnson at 302-571-4415.
